    Autopsy: When is it necessary and when can it be avoided?

    A death often brings about the dilemma of whether an autopsy is necessary and under what circumstances it can be avoided. An autopsy serves not only to determine the cause of death but also plays an important role in public health, as it contributes to the understanding of diseases and causes of mortality. Furthermore, it helps in assessing the effectiveness of diagnostic and therapeutic procedures. The question of autopsy is also regulated by laws that precisely define when and under what conditions a pathological examination is mandatory.     The Post-Mortem State: The Role of Cadavers in Medical Education

    A dissection, as an integral part of medical training, has always played a central role in medical education. A detailed understanding of the human body is essential for doctors, as the foundation of healing activities is a thorough knowledge of the body’s structure and function. The dissection of cadavers provides an opportunity for future doctors to study the complexity of human anatomy in real conditions. While modern technology and computer models continue to evolve, the direct experience that dissection offers is still irreplaceable.     Drug Use Detection from Saliva Sample

    A modern medical technology is constantly evolving, creating opportunities for rapid and effective diagnosis. Identifying various toxins and illegal substances poses a significant challenge for healthcare institutions and professionals, especially in emergency situations. In many cases, the patient arrives unconscious and is unable to provide information about what substances they have consumed, thus complicating treatment. New technological advancements, such as the latest laboratory instruments, represent a significant step forward in the detection of drugs and toxins. These tools are essential not only in the world of sports but also in the toxicology departments of hospitals, as they provide rapid and reliable results.
